find dy/dx of y = squrt ln x?

OpenStudy (anonymous):

dy/dx = 1/(2x(sqrt ln x)) To solve, make the equation: y^2 = ln x And differentiate.

OpenStudy (anonymous):

To see this, let \[u=\ln x \]Then, the chain rule says\[dy/dx=(dy/du)(du/dx)\]We have:\[dy/du=1/(2\sqrt{u})\]And,\[du/dx=1/x\]So,\[dy/dx=(dy/du)(du/dx)=(1/(2\sqrt{u})(1/x)\]Replacing u= lnx our final answer is\[dy/dx=1/(2x \sqrt{lnx})\]
